Bath Short Story Award 2025
The Bath Short Story Award 2025 is an exciting literary competition open to writers aged 16 and above. Organized by Jude Higgins, Jane Riekemann, and Alison Woodhouse, this competition invites entrants to submit original short stories that are written in English.
